Jan 23, 2024 · To calculate the average selling price we divide the total revenue of $4,000 by 200 T-shirts, getting an ASP of $20 per T-shirt. Nov 9, 2023 · The cost per unit is: ($30,000 Fixed costs + $50,000 variable costs) ÷ 10,000 units = $8 cost per unit. In the following month, ABC produces 5,000 units at a variable cost of $25,000 and the same fixed cost of $30,000. Shares had risen by aro... InvestorPlace - Stock Market N...The "Unit Price" (or "unit cost") tells us the cost per liter, per kilogram, per pound, etc, of what we want to buy. Just divide the cost by the quantity: Example: 2 liters for $3.80 is $3.80/2 liters = $1.90 per liter Let the unit price label do the work for you. Unit price is the price at which a single quantity of a product is being sold. This can refer to the price per unit of measure, such as the price per pound, ounce, or pin.
